Hi. Was glad to find a place like this for a little help. Have a 79 Beachcraft with 185OMC and an OMC 800. There is just a little "play" in the outdrive. Basically, I can grab it and rotate it back and forth just a little bit and when we're trolling the boat wont stay on a straight path. Kinda swims back and forth. I know there's a worm gear that is part of the steering and am wondering if there's any way to adjust the "backlash" out of it or a kit to replace all the gears? Or any other options to fix the situation? Thanks for reading.

How much play are you talking about? There is going to be a small amount in the drive. Mine has a little but will hold a straight course for a long way at speed. Trolling at slow speed you will not be able to hold straight unless in very calm water.

all boats with single i/o's do the "drunken swagger" at slow speed.

if steering is fine on plane, then steering is probably fine - you could check the trucourse gear but it's not a common wear area
there are tensioners for the steering cable you can tighten that might help - they are plastic nuts - labelled "NUT" in top pic of this link:

you just snug them by hand

you'll learn to not overcompensate with time. On some boats, a 4 blade prop helps the sway.

Some Smart Tabs will also nearly eliminate the wander at low speed & help get on plane faster. I have 1/8-3/16" play back & forth in my drive. Nothing wrong with it.
